Ubuntu kernel 5.18v-rc1 includes the sound patches that fix sound for LENOVO_MT_82N6_BU_idea_FM_Legion 7 16ACHg6 : https://kernel.ubuntu.com/~kernel-ppa/mainline/v5.18-rc1/ Thank you everyone for all your efforts! -- You received this bug notification because you are a member of Desktop
